Area:Usk

Beat:Glan-y-Cafn

Fishing:Trout (River)

No. of Anglers:1

River was slightly coloured and low. Nonetheless, there was a steady late morning rise which targeted a mixture of lacewings and mayflys. The hatch died off at lunch time and did not return. 2 x 1lb+ brown trout were taken on small, gold head nymphs. Fished across the current and stripped back. 2 x 6-7" brown trout taken in a similar manner on similar technique, all fish returned in good condition. A mink was spotted halfway down the beat by the old croy. A great days sport!

4 Trout

Area:Usk

Beat:Cefn Rhosan Fawr

Fishing:All Species (in season)

No. of Anglers:2

We were looking for a day of dry fly fishing - from 12 - 3 o'clock there was plenty of fly life and the fish duly obliged - it took us a while to work out they were taking emerging flies and once we changed to fish a CDC emerger - 4 fish came in quick succession. And then it was over, the fly life disappeared and for 2 hours we looked longingly at the river with barely a rise before packing up and heading home.

4 Trout

Area:Monnow

Beat:Escley Beat 4

Fishing:Trout (River)

No. of Anglers:1

26 to hand today all released safely. Spent 5 hours on beat covering rises from the larger fish today. All fish fell for cdc loopwing emerger (mayfly). Several shook hook also. Largest three were all roughly 14 inches, ten or so 12 inches the rest around the ten inch mark. Water levels dropping and with the glaring sun made for a stealthy approach. Lovely day on the Escley.

26 Trout
